Abbott is a global healthcare leader that helps people live more fully at all stages of life. Our portfolio of life-changing technologies spans the spectrum of healthcare, with leading businesses and products in diagnostics, medical devices, nutritionals and branded generic medicines. Our 114,000 colleagues serve people in more than 160 countries. Requirements

  • High School Diploma or GED
  • 3 years or more of related experience OR an equivalent combination of education and work experience

Nice To Haves

  • Some college or vocational schooling
  • 3 or more years of Liquid Experience in both RPB & Fill/packaging Operations
  • Excellent written, verbal, analytical, and mechanical skills with proficiency in various computer systems and software
  • Highly motivated and self driven to effectively manage multi-tasks in a dynamic, team-oriented environment while utilizing good judgment, effective communication, and strong problem solving skills

Responsibilities

  • Assisting with project management.
  • Investigates, identifies, and helps correct inventory discrepancies.
  • Perform Administrative duties as required (i.e. meetings, data collection & analysis, trend reports, month/quarter end closeout, budgets, orders supplies, etc).
  • Communicates with Deployment, TPM, Plant QA/TPM QA, and CSO to assure customer needs are met in regards to project related action items.
  • Coordinates contractor activities onsite.
  • Provides backup coverage for all warehouse functions.
  • All other project work assigned.
